How Diet Affects Blood Test Results
A patient's diet plays a vital role in determining the accuracy of their blood Test Results. Here are some ways in which diet can affect different types of blood tests:
-
Fasting Blood Glucose Test: One of the most commonly performed blood tests is the Fasting Blood Glucose test, which measures the amount of sugar in the blood after a period of Fasting. A patient's diet, specifically their intake of carbohydrates and sugars, can impact the results of this test. Consuming a high-carbohydrate meal before the test can lead to elevated blood sugar levels, resulting in a misdiagnosis of diabetes or prediabetes.
-
Lipid Profile Test: The Lipid Profile Test measures various types of cholesterol and fats in the blood. A diet high in saturated fats and cholesterol can skew the results of this test, leading to a misinterpretation of the patient's risk for heart disease and other cardiovascular conditions.
-
Iron Levels Test: Iron levels in the blood can be affected by the patient's intake of iron-rich foods and supplements. Consuming too much or too little iron can result in inaccurate Test Results and may lead to unnecessary treatments or missed diagnoses of conditions such as anemia.
The Role of Nutritional Intake in Blood Test Accuracy
In addition to diet, a patient's overall nutritional intake can impact the accuracy of blood Test Results. Nutrient deficiencies or excesses can cause abnormal results in various blood tests, leading to potential misdiagnoses and inappropriate treatments. Here are some examples of how nutritional intake can affect blood test accuracy:
-
Vitamin D Levels Test: Adequate intake of vitamin D is essential for maintaining healthy bones and immune function. A deficiency in vitamin D can result in low blood levels of this nutrient, which may be misinterpreted as a sign of a bone disorder or immune system dysfunction.
-
Protein Levels Test: Proteins are essential for building and repairing tissues in the body. A diet low in protein can lead to low blood protein levels, which may be mistaken for liver or kidney disease. Conversely, excessive protein intake can also affect certain blood tests, such as kidney function tests.
-
Electrolyte Levels Test: Electrolytes such as sodium, potassium, and calcium play a crucial role in various bodily functions, including nerve and muscle function. Imbalances in electrolyte levels due to dietary factors can result in abnormal blood Test Results that may indicate underlying health problems.
Strategies for Ensuring Accurate Blood Test Results
Given the significant impact of diet and nutritional intake on blood test accuracy, it is essential for Healthcare Providers and patients to take steps to ensure reliable Test Results. Here are some strategies that can help improve the accuracy of blood tests in a medical lab setting:
Education and Counseling
Healthcare Providers should educate patients about the importance of diet and nutrition in influencing blood Test Results. Providing dietary counseling can help patients make informed decisions about their food choices and understand how their diet affects their health and lab tests.
Standardized Testing Protocols
Medical labs should implement standardized testing protocols that take into account the potential effects of diet and nutrition on blood Test Results. This may include specific Fasting requirements or Dietary Restrictions before certain tests to ensure accurate and consistent results.
Interpretation with Context
When analyzing blood Test Results, Healthcare Providers should consider the patient's diet and nutritional habits in the interpretation of the findings. Taking a holistic approach to patient care can help prevent misdiagnoses and ensure that treatment decisions are based on accurate information.
Follow-Up Testing
In cases where dietary factors may have influenced blood Test Results, Healthcare Providers should consider repeat testing after addressing any potential dietary issues. This can help confirm the accuracy of the initial results and provide a more reliable assessment of the patient's health status.
